Author: | Namwoon, K. Mahajan, V. |
Title: | Determining the going market value of a business in an emerging information technology industry: the case of the cellular communications industry |
Journal: | Technological Forecasting and Social Change
1995 : JUL, VOL. 49:3, p. 257-280 |
Index terms: | TECHNOLOGY INFORMATION COMMUNICATIONS INDUSTRY |
Language: | eng |
Abstract: | Given the phenomenal growth or the anticipation of growth in certain information technology industries, concerns for economy of scale, market access and expansion, and the need for ongoing research and development are resulting in mergers, acquisitions, and strategic alliances. A key question in such industries is what is, or should be the going market value of a business? This paper suggests an approach to imbed market penetration models in the popular value-based planning approach suggested by Rappaport to obtain the going market value of a business. |
